EndNote and Reference Manager Citation formats compared to "instructions to authors" in top medical journals
Frances A. Brahmi,Carole Gall +1 more
TLDR
This study compared citation format in EndNote® version 7 and Reference Manager® version 11 with the citation format for references found in the instructions to authors from the most significant medical literature.Abstract:
The study compared citation format in EndNote version 7 and Reference Manager version 11 with the citation format for references found in the instructions to authors from the most significant medical literature. The resulting information should be very useful to those who depend on citation management software to format and organize their references for publication in medicine, and librarians and others who teach the use of citation management software.read more
